What It's Like Staying in North Zone, India
North India spans an enormous geographic and cultural range - from the dense urban corridors of Uttar Pradesh to the cool altitude retreats of Uttarakhand and Himachal Pradesh. Accommodation quality varies dramatically between city centers and hill towns, and transport connectivity differs widely depending on whether you're in a plains city like Kanpur or a mountain destination like Mussoorie. Hill stations have limited road access during monsoon, and urban centers like Kanpur operate on auto-rickshaws, cabs, and local buses rather than metro systems. Budget and mid-range travelers benefit most from staying in North Zone, particularly those combining business in tier-2 cities with weekend hill escapes. Luxury seekers may find the lack of premium inventory in some cities a constraint. Around 60% of domestic Indian tourism flows through North India seasonally, making early planning essential for hill stations especially.
Pros:
- Exceptional variety of terrain - plains, foothills, and Himalayan destinations within a few hours' drive
- Strong domestic travel infrastructure with frequent train and road connections between major cities
- FabHotel-style standardized properties offer predictable quality in cities where unbranded hotels vary wildly
Cons:
- Hill station roads can become severely congested during peak season and monsoon, adding significant travel time
- Air quality in plains cities like Kanpur can be poor in winter months (November-January)
- Limited walkability in most North Indian cities - local transport is almost always required

Practical Booking & Area Strategy for North Zone
For Mussoorie specifically, book at least 6 weeks in advance for travel between April and June - this is India's peak domestic hill station season when rooms at reliable branded properties sell out fast and prices climb sharply. Dehradun serves as a gateway city to Mussoorie (around 35 km away via a winding mountain road), making it a viable lower-cost base if Mussoorie rates are too high. Kanpur, by contrast, operates on business travel rhythms - weekday rates are often higher than weekends. Gun Hill Point and Mall Road are the primary pedestrian-friendly zones in Mussoorie, while Kanpur's key districts like Swaroop Nagar and Civil Lines anchor commercial and transit activity. For Dehradun, proximity to the Jolly Grant Airport (roughly 30 km from the city center) and Dehradun Railway Station should guide your property selection. If you're planning to cover multiple destinations - say Kanpur for business and Mussoorie for leisure - plan a minimum of 2 nights per location to avoid being rushed by transfer times on mountain roads.

Smart Travel & Timing Advice for North Zone FabHotels
The Mussoorie and Dehradun properties experience their sharpest demand spike between late March and mid-June, when temperatures on the plains push domestic Indian travelers toward hill stations - this is the single most competitive booking window in North India's leisure hotel market. October and November offer a strong alternative: post-monsoon clarity, lower crowd levels, and more competitive rates, though some Mussoorie properties reduce services in the shoulder season. Kanpur's hotel demand follows a flatter curve tied to business calendars, with slight dips during major Indian public holidays. For Mussoorie specifically, a minimum 2-night stay is recommended - the road journey from Dehradun absorbs time, and a single night doesn't justify the logistics. For Kanpur, single-night stays are common and perfectly efficient. Avoid booking Uttarakhand hill properties last-minute in May - verified branded options like FabHotel Sapphire in Mussoorie can be fully booked weeks out during peak season, leaving travelers with poorly reviewed alternatives at higher prices.
